Governance and Data ManagementGovernance1.7Please provide information specifically on the impact of the COVID-19 economic response on climate action in your city and synergies between COVID-19 recovery interventions and climate action.1ResponseNo change on finance available for climate actionRecovery interventions that boost public and sustainable transport optionsThe number of vehicles travelling on our roadways appears to be trending to pre-pandemic levels, where transit ridership dropped significantly. The city is working on an Integrated Mobility Plan with a focus on moving people and not cars, as was traditionally done with Master Transportation Plans. Recent support from residents for separated bike lanes in Burlington has been noted as many people did take up cycling during the pandemic. Burlington Transit is transitioning back to full service in September, based on service improvements implemented back in 2019 prior to the pandemic which resulted in a 14% increase in ridership. Burlington Transit is also studying the feasibility of transitioning buses to either electric or hydrogen to reduce the carbon footprint of the bus fleet. A full report on recommended zero emission bus options will be presented in the first quarter of 2022.

We have also followed our planned increase in funding, and this increase in funding does support recovery from the COVID-19 pandemic.The council has created a public realm fund worth £5m which will ensure the Council’s investment in its public spaces is boosted, with targeted interventions focussed around some key areas, ranging from improving the look and feel of our town centres to the smartening up of street scenes, to parks, river path and road crossing improvements, plus the planting of more trees. This will be focussed on areas of the borough that have experienced significant additional activity over the past year as residents have adapted to restrictions and made the most of their local area. It is important the Council invests in its public realm where necessary to support residents and businesses to recover as fully as possible.The Council secured government funding of over £2m through the Green Homes Grant Local Authority Delivery scheme to deliver whole house retrofits to those most likely to be in fuel poverty. This includes upgrades to Wandsworth’s own social housing stock and improvements to an over 200 homes across the borough. This work is delivered in partnership with Wandsworth based cooperative Retrofit Works, recently announced as being part of the government’s taskforce for the green economy. The scheme supports existing, and creates new, green jobs in the borough. The Council’s own housing stock of 16,000 tenanted homes will also be assessed to develop a pathway to net zero. In 2020 The Council secured £55,679 funding for ecargo bikes from the Department for Transport (administered by Energy Saving Trust) to be used to provide ecargo bikes for the Council and for participating businesses and organisations. Recipients of the bikes include the Council’s Inspection and Enforcement and Parks Police teams, together with local businesses and charities. The project aims to increase the profile of ecargo bikes and their diverse and scalable uses, reducing journeys made by car and van within the Council’s operations and across the borough. Recognising the potential to scale-up this scheme through 2021, Wandsworth released some of its Climate Change Fund to enable more businesses to utilise cargo-bikes, together with pilots for the reallocation of kerbside parking for cargo bike parking.The Council approved positive General Fund revenue budget variations of £380,000 in 2020/21, £250,000 in 2021/22 and £100,000 in 2022/23, to be funded from reserves, to supplement existing budgets and new funding bids for the initial phase of the recovery action plan.The proposed action plan does require some additional funding in the short term for Children’s Services (expansion of the virtual school and roll out of a tutoring pilot) and the EDO (to expand support to businesses, the Work Match service and to improve town/district centres). Additional General Fund revenue budget totalling £730,000 over three financial years would therefore be required, to be met from reserves. Positive General Fund revenue budget variations of £380,000 in 2020/21, £250,000 in 2021/22 and £100,000 in 2022/23 only are therefore recommended for approval. Whilst some of this investment would be one off, some of the schemes are assumed at this stage to run for two years with no further funding beyond that.Further costings and any additional resources/investment required will become clearer as the action plan is reviewed. It is important that any investment is targeted appropriately to protect the Council’s income sources and reduce demand for statutory services where possible whilst supporting the overall economic prosperity of the borough.The Council continued to support delivery of local schemes. “Power to Connect” is Wandsworth’s award-winning scheme to provide laptops and internet access to vulnerable cohorts and to deliver laptops through the government scheme. The Council recognises how inclusive action to tackle climate change and promote local businesses and large-scale regeneration can guide innovation and futureproof the local economy, creating healthier places for all who live, work and play in the borough

The dataset contains 2021 data on the impact of COVID-19 on finance available for climate action in cities. The data was reported by cities through the CDP-ICLEI Unified Reporting System in response to question 1.7 ("Please provide information specifically on the impact of the COVID-19 economic response on climate action in your city and synergies between COVID-19 recovery interventions and climate action.") in the 2021 Cities questionnaire.
